Asserting some fifteen million members, Scientology is an outgrowth of a study called Dianetics, initiated by L. Ron Hubbard. An achieved sci-fi and novel author in the 1930s, Hubbard published a non-fiction publication in 1948 entitled Dianetics: The Modern Science of Mental Health And Wellness. In this publication, the writer provided ideas and methods for promoting mental, emotional and spiritual perfection.


The teachings of Scientology are not doctrinal (God-centered) in nature, however rather expound a method of optimizing individual possibility. Scientology technique purposes to reveal and get rid of built up negative and agonizing experiences in the spirit of the candidate. A number of these "engrams," as they are called, are believed to be obtained by the embryo in the womb or in a multitude of past lives.




The cleaning of engrams from previous lives seems very closely associated to the Hindu teaching of fate and reincarnation. The concept important source of "fate" teaches that an individual spirit, over the training course of many life times, experiences incentives and punishments in order to ultimately stabilize past and existing actions (Scientology). The E-meter (or Electro-psychometer) is the auditor's tool and is utilized as a confessional help in Scientology. It is a kind of lie detector that sends a moderate electric current with the check my site body of the Seeker. Scientologists think that the E-Meter has the ability to detect Body Thetans and past psychological traumas whether they occurred the other day or in a previous life millions of years back.




They no much longer hold on to the harassed Thetan. Throughout the process of auditing, many individual and penetrating questions are asked. As the Pre-Clear realizes the "truth-detecting" cylinders of the E-Meter, an Auditor commonly asks, "Have you done anything your mom would certainly repent to learn?" Admissions are frequently assisted into locations of sexual behavior, of both present and past lives.
